OUR NEW SCHOOL '-0' The ground for the New Norris City Community Unit High School was broken July 1, 1948 by Mr. Dan V. Morehead, president of the School Board. The contractors, Johnson, Drake and Piper of Terre Haute began the eighteen months' construction job immediately. Mr. Ralph Legeman of Evansville, nationally known architect, designed this ultra-modern building equipped with the following innovations and facilities: ' Theatre-type auditorium with seating capacity of 450. Cafeteria with chromium and steel equipment. a The first gymnasium of its kind in southern Illinois. Floor, 70'x110', seating- capacity of 3,500. Enlarged Commercial Department seventy feet long, designed to accomodate forty typewriters and other business machines. Home Economics Department equipped with the newest and finest kitchen and laundry facilities. Clinic room to be used by the visiting nurse and in case of emer- gency. Mechanical drawing and drafting room. Farm shop in conjunction with Manual Arts Shop. Photographic dark room. The entire building has the latest lighting and heating facilities.
